public announcement
so i held off on mentioning this publically (though some people have heard by now.) basically, for obvious reasons, i didn't want to put this out there till everyone at my work was informed.

at any rate...

this is my last week at gamesradar. next monday, i will begin a new job at gamasutra as the features editor.

for those who are not familiar with the site, gamasutra is run alongside its sister publication game developer magazine as a resource for game developers. that's its intended audience. as i find myself getting more interested in the creative process behind games (and increasingly disinterested in the product cycle of games -- unveil/preview/review/forget) it seems like a good match to me. i'm eager to give it a shot, and more than a little burnt out on the plain-vanilla game journalism deal.

so, you'll still be seeing me around on the web, though maybe not where you expected.
